Remote Warrior: Building the First Trauma-Informed System for Remote Combat Veterans

My name is Tanner Yackley. I’m a former MQ-9 Sensor Operator and Evaluator, and the founder of Remote Warrior LLC, a veteran-led initiative addressing the invisible trauma of Remote Combat Warriors (RCWs). This includes drone crews, ISR analysts, and intelligence professionals who often return home with no blood on their boots but deep trauma in their nervous systems.Our work is shaped by those who have lived it. Nearly every member of our small but growing team is an affected veteran. We are building the first trauma-informed system made specifically for our community and for the systems that failed us.

📊 Why It Matters

There are over 250,000 Remote Combat Warriors in the United States.That is more than the entire Special Operations community.More than fighter pilots. More than bomber crews.Yet we have:No trauma-specific intake at the VANo tailored mental health trackNo transition programs that reflect our experienceNo systems that recognize how we were affectedWe are the largest combat-exposed community in the Air Force. And we are still being overlooked.
